I have a problem with BG2-W modem, ATS0=1 is ignoring PSTN voice call. Even I hung up the incoming call it won't respond as "NO CARRIER". I just receive RING characters. Only works with manual "ATA" answer.
But when I initiate a CSD call, auto answer is working fine.
Hi,
BGS2 only will autoanswer DATA CSD Calls.

Hi, please, what the difference from Voice and DATA call?
i call from US robotics 56k fax modem, ad cinterion BGS2t configured ATS0=2, on serial monitor i see the RING incoming call, but not automatic answer., someone can help me please ?
Hello,
please answer this call manually and check with command:
AT+CLCC
if it's DATA / FAX / VOICE call
The difference is how UE/NW indicates type of call when trying to establish it.
UE/NW then properly configures audio filters/generators to have best match for task (human voice transfer or CSD data transfer or FAX transfer)
